VANS
Vans was founded in 1966 by brothers Paul and James Van Doren, along with Gordon C. Lee, who opened a small shoe factory and retail store in California. In that time and geographical place, the most successful sports were surfing and skateboarding. It was March 16, 1966, the day the first Vans store opened in Anaheim, California. A store where shoes were made to order, a useful strategy for saving on production costs and thus increasing profits. In March 2016, Vans celebrated its 50th anniversary. Years of great innovation and growth that made Vans the brand we know today.
